Fullers Foods International in Leeds is seeking an Administrative Support specialist for our Technical and ESG teams. This role includes managing customer complaints, ensuring compliance with food safety and quality standards, and maintaining accurate data records.
The ideal candidate will excel in organization, has experience in administrative tasks, and a strong focus on communication and efficiency. Join us in our mission to deliver high-quality food supply services.
